Dubai Marina and Jumeirah Beach Residence JBR: A contemporary family friendly hub
The Dubai Marina area feels like a pedestrian friendly village with a modern twist. It is built around a sparkling canal and a 7 km promenade that is perfect for morning strolls with kids in tow. Families tend to love the wide sidewalks, shallow water viewing points and plenty of casual dining that suits all tastes. JBR The Beach is a flagship outdoor space where you can enjoy a breezy afternoon, watch boats glide by and stop for gelato or a light lunch with the family.
Why it suits families you ask; the entire harbour front is designed with safety and ease in mind. There are playgrounds tucked along the promenade, easily accessible restrooms, and gentle water views that spark curiosity in little explorers without leaving the safety net of a compact area. It is also easy to combine with a short Dubai Marina Mall shopping visit or a kid friendly harbour cruise if your schedule allows.
Local experiences in this area
- Take a short dhow cruise along the canal to see residential towers from a different angle without leaving the family wagon for long.
- Stroll The Walk at JBR for a mix of eateries and street performers. It is a safe, lively scene on most evenings and weekends.
- Book a sunset boat ride with calm waters especially for families who want a gentle introduction to the waterfront.
- Visit The Beach at JBR for kid friendly sand and shallow water play zones near cafés and gelaterias.

Downtown Dubai: Iconic convenience for curious kids and active adults
Downtown Dubai offers a compact, walkable core where iconic sights anchor day trips. The area is known for its abundance of shaded pedestrian routes, strong safety standards and a world class shopping and dining scene. It is an ideal base for families who want a central launchpad to a week of city adventures.
The Burj Khalifa and Dubai Mall form a twin heartbeat here. While the tower attracts many visitors, there are plenty of family friendly ways to enjoy the area without feeling rushed. The Dubai Fountain shows are a favourite for families with small children, and the surrounding parks give little legs a place to stretch while you plan the next stop.
What to do with kids in Downtown Dubai
- Visit the Dubai Aquarium and Underwater Zoo located inside Dubai Mall for a memorable indoor encounter with marine life.
- Watch a fountain show from the shaded terraces along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Boulevard in the evenings.
- Explore the Opera District for kid friendly performances or interactive installations during festival periods.
- Head to a kid friendly cafe in Souk Al Bahar and enjoy a view of the Burj Khalifa from the creek side.
Families who prefer a more relaxed pace will appreciate the open spaces around Burj Park and the family friendly dining options nearby. Palm Jumeirah and the Palm Crescent: Beach life with easy access to entertainment
The Palm is famous for its palm shaped crescent and its sandy coves. It feels like a resort suburb and still keeps a strong sense of residential life. Beach days are straightforward here thanks to well placed public access points and calm seas. The Palm also offers a handful of family friendly dining choices that are suited to kids and adults who crave a relaxed atmosphere after a day in the sun.
Families visiting Palm Jumeirah often combine a beach morning with a visit to facilities at nearby Atlantis or the Aquaventure waterpark for a splashing afternoon. Even if you opt for a lightweight day, the gentle pace and iconic surroundings provide a sense of retreat within the city.
Local experiences on the crescent
- Beach time at public access bays with lifeguards on duty during busy hours.
- Casual bike rides along the waterfront with family friendly cafes at regular intervals.
- Short rides to nearby The Lost Chambers Aquarium for curious minds and curious little ones.
- Evening strolls to catch sunset reflections on glass facades and water features along the promenade.

Deira and Al Seef: Heritage pockets and markets that delight curious minds
Deira is the historic pulse of Dubai, where old meets new in a friendly, bustle filled way. It offers a different flavour from the newer districts with heritage streets, spice markets, and traditional waterways that invite family walks and quiet observation.
Al Seef on the Dubai Creek edge blends traditional souk style with modern comforts. It is a lovely place to stroll with kids, sampling local snacks, watching boats pass and learning a little about Dubai's trading past. This area also serves as a cost effective base for families who want to experience Dubai without the crowds of more central zones.
What to explore as a family
- Dubai Museum in the Al Fahidi Fort to learn about the emirate’s journey from desert outpost to global hub.
- Traditional souk strolls along the creek, with sweet treats and spice aromas filling the air.
- Al Seef district for photo worthy corners and easy access to boats and river views.
- Evening dhow cruises that offer gentle navigation with informative commentary and that sense of discovery for kids.
When planning a Deira stay, you may appreciate the straightforward metro links to other neighbourhoods and the reassuring network of safe paths for family nights out. Al Barsha and Mall of the Emirates area: A hub for shopping, snow and family fun
The Al Barsha corridor is a practical base for families because it keeps a balanced mix of nature, shopping and kid focussed attractions within easy reach. Mall of the Emirates is a focal point here and its indoor snow centre adds a playful contrast for kids who want to see snow in the desert.
Beyond the mall, Al Barsha hosts parks, easy grab and go dining and a cluster of cafes that welcome families with high chairs and kids menus. The proximity to the Dubai Metro line also makes it simple to reach Downtown Dubai or the Marina without long drives.
Family friendly activities in this area
- Snow Park at Mall of the Emirates for a day of winter style fun in the desert climate.
- Outdoor playgrounds and shaded seating around Al Barsha Pond Park to give children space to run and parents a seat in the shade.
- Family friendly cinema complexes with late afternoon showings for a relaxed end to the day.
- Choices for casual dining with options that cater to different dietary needs.

Mirdif and Dubai Hills Estate: Quiet suburb living with space to breathe
For families who prefer leafy streets, lower noise levels and accessible parks, Mirdif offers a calmer rhythm away from the heavy traffic and crowding often found in the more central locations. It is still within easy reach of the city centre by car or public transport. Dubai Hills Estate is a newer family friendly suburb that blends green spaces, walkable boulevards and family oriented community facilities.
Both areas are ideal if your family hinges on convenience and safety. Mirdif is well served by shopping hubs and a local vibe with markets that feel more neighbourhood than tourist heavy. Dubai Hills Estate brings a modern suburban plan with large parks, scaled back traffic and a sense of community that many families find reassuring.
What families do here
- Picnic days in spacious parks with shade and safe playgrounds for different ages.
- Easy access to family friendly golf courses and cycle paths that suit varied skill levels.
- Neighbourhood cafes offering child friendly menus and areas to stretch out with a stroller or scooter.
- Local farmers markets where families can sample fresh produce and discover regional snacks.

Practical planning tips for families touring Dubai
A successful family trip rests on easy transport, predictable routines and space to unwind after a busy day. Here are practical tips to help you navigate the city with children.
Getting around
- Dubai has a comprehensive Metro network that links many neighbourhoods including Downtown Dubai and Dubai Marina. It is a comfortable option for families who want to avoid heavy traffic and parking hassles.
- Trams connect Dubai Marina and bluewaters areas with the Metro, giving you flexibility and reducing transfers with a stroller.
- Rideshare options and taxis are reliable and widely available. If you have young kids or a stroller, plan a few short rides rather than long drives in peak heat.
Safety and comfort
- Always carry water and sun protection. Dubai sunshine is bright and the shade can be a relief for little ones.
- Dress codes indoors are modest and respectful in many venues. Lightweight clothing and comfortable shoes make a big difference in hot weather.
- Public play areas are generally well maintained, but keep a close eye on children near water or moving crowds in busy areas.
Tasteful planning and pacing
- Balance shopping days with lighter experiences for kids. A long mall day can be draining; mix it with a park or a water based activity.
- Schedule mid day breaks for rest or a quiet snack to avoid meltdowns during peak heat hours.
- Book activities with a time buffer in case a child wants extra time at a favourite spot.

Five day sample family itinerary focused on neighbourhoods
This flexible plan helps you see a mix of neighbourhood highlights and local experiences while keeping the pace friendly for children. Adapt as needed based on heat, nap times and your family preferences.
Day 1 Dubai Marina and JBR
- Morning walk along the promenade, spotting boats and enjoying sea breezes.
- Lunch at a family friendly cafe with outdoor seating and water views.
- Afternoon at The Beach at JBR with a gentle play zone and light bites for the family.
Day 2 Downtown Dubai
- Visit the Dubai Mall Aquarium and Underwater Zoo for an easy indoor morning.
- Head to Burj Khalifa observation deck if weather and crowds permit; otherwise relax in the park nearby.
- Evening fountain show and kid friendly dinner in Souk Al Bahar.
Day 3 Al Barsha and Mall of the Emirates
- Morning snow experience for kids at Snow Park Dubai or a relaxed park nearby.
- Lunch near the mall followed by light shopping or a cinema visit in the afternoon.
- Evening stroll in a nearby park and casual dinner with options for halal and diverse cuisines.
Day 4 Deira and Al Seef
- Dubai Creekside walk and short dhow trip if weather permits.
- Spice and Gold souk exploration with careful pacing and breaks for snacks.
- Dessert or light snacks on the Al Seef promenade as you watch the sunset over the creek.
Day 5 A quieter suburb day
- Visit a local park in Mirdif or Dubai Hills Estate for a relaxed morning.
- Family picnic or casual cycling together through safe, shade filled paths.
- Farewell dinner at a family friendly restaurant that offers a variety of dishes and a kid friendly menu.
